Farm Robotics Challenge

Industry Engagement Opportunities

 

Sponsor the brightest young ag robotic developers as they create real-world solutions. Showcasing engineering, computer science, and critical thinking ability, student teams will program a farm robot to perform and automate an essential farm function on any crop or farm size using the Farm-Ng robotics platform with real-life farm automation challenges led by the University of California.

  • Up to 10 teams from top agriculture and robotics universities in the U.S.
  • Leverages commercial technology and an open software and hardware platform to work towards market-ready solutions.
  • An exciting project to attract students to robotics careers in agriculture.
  • Aimed at creating a collaborative community of young robotics engineers Solutions aimed at appropriate technology for farms of all sizes.
  • Sponsors participate in a vital AgTech workforce development program.
